Vermont Sen. Bernie Sanders drops campaign for president
Story Date: 4/9/2020

 

Source: Stephanie Akin, ROLL CALL, 4/8/20


Vermont Sen. Bernie Sanders suspended his presidential campaign Wednesday, clearing the way for former Vice President Joe Biden to win the Democratic nomination. In a speech streamed over the internet, the 78-year-old independent told supporters the ideas he pushed won support in states across the political spectrum, including a $15 minimum wage, health care for all, moving away from fossil fuels for energy and tuition-free college education.
